what is the main difference between rename and label? (don't
say that they both perform the same function).
Answer Posted / rajaanku11
1. Label is global and rename is local i.e., label statement
can be used either in proc or datastep where as rename
should be used only in datastep.
2.If we rename a variable, old name will be lost but if we
label a variable its short name(old name) exists along with
it's descriptive name.
